[llvm-commits] CVS: llvm/lib/Target/Sparc/SparcRegInfo.h

Brian Gaeke gaeke at cs.uiuc.edu
Thu Jan 15 12:18:00 PST 2004


Changes in directory llvm/lib/Target/Sparc:

SparcRegInfo.h updated: 1.7 -> 1.8

---
Log message:

Include TargetRegInfo.h and declare SparcTargetMachine forward, to make this
header more easily includable.


---
Diffs of the changes:  (+4 -1)

Index: llvm/lib/Target/Sparc/SparcRegInfo.h
diff -u llvm/lib/Target/Sparc/SparcRegInfo.h:1.7 llvm/lib/Target/Sparc/SparcRegInfo.h:1.8
--- llvm/lib/Target/Sparc/SparcRegInfo.h:1.7	Wed Dec 17 16:04:00 2003
+++ llvm/lib/Target/Sparc/SparcRegInfo.h	Thu Jan 15 12:17:07 2004
@@ -14,8 +14,12 @@
 #ifndef SPARC_REGINFO_H
 #define SPARC_REGINFO_H
 
+#include "llvm/Target/TargetRegInfo.h"
+
 namespace llvm {
 
+class SparcTargetMachine;
+
 class SparcRegInfo : public TargetRegInfo {
 
 private:
@@ -138,7 +142,6 @@
   inline int getSpilledRegSize(int RegType) const {
     return 8;
   }
-
 
   // To obtain the return value and the indirect call address (if any)
   // contained in a CALL machine instruction





More information about the llvm-commits mailing list